#746b5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#746b5e is composed of 45.5% red, 42%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 7.8% magenta, 19%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 35.5 degrees, a saturation of 10.5% and a lightness of 41.2%. #746b5e color hex could be obtained by blending #e8d6bc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#746b5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080706 is the darkest color, while #fcfcfc is the lightest one.
